5 AWSM Population - Hanumangarh, Rajasthan

5 AWSM is a small village located in Hanumangarh Tehsil of Hanumangarh district, Rajasthan with total 18 families residing. The 5 AWSM village has population of 101 of which 54 are males while 47 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In 5 AWSM village population of children with age 0-6 is 13 which makes up 12.87 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of 5 AWSM village is 870 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the 5 AWSM as per census is 625,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.

5 AWSM village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of 5 AWSM village was 68.18 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In 5 AWSM Male literacy stands at 84.78 % while female literacy rate was 50.00 %.

Caste Factor

In 5 AWSM village, most of the villagers are from Schedule Caste (SC).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 68.32 % of total population in 5 AWSM village. The village 5 AWSM curr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In 5 AWSM village out of total population, 59 were engaged in work activities. 61.02 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 38.98 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 59 workers engaged in Main Work, 32 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
